# Runbook: Dependency Pinning

All Skerrylight services pin exact dependency versions — no ranges, no wildcards. The lockfile is the source of truth; the manifest is documentation. Upgrades happen only via the weekly bump job, which opens a review branch. Never upgrade in a feature branch, even for a security fix; flag it to the on-call instead and they'll fast-track the bump. CI rejects any build whose resolved tree differs from the lockfile. The bump job itself is driven by the configuration below, which you should not edit by hand.

settings of yaguf-bahip:
druwyn:
  log_level: debug
  metrics_host: metrics.druwyn.qorvelsys.internal
  pool_size: 32

## Service Accounts — Mergewell Dedup Pipeline

The Mergewell deduplication job runs under the svc-dedup account, which has read access to customer records and write access only to the merge-candidates table. Rotation happens quarterly; the owner is the data platform team. For this sprint's reprocessing run, the job authenticates against the Harlock matching service with the following key.

API key for yahig-tadup: kto7_ubizbYm

Hello plugin authors,

Next Thursday, Corbexa will run a disaster-recovery drill for the RestockRoute vending-machine restock planner. During the failover window, plugin callbacks will be replayed against the standby scheduler, so please ensure your handlers are idempotent and tolerate duplicate route assignments. No customer restock data will be altered. To re-register your plugin against the standby environment during the drill, authenticate with the recovery passphrase provided below.

vault phrase of hahip-tajeg = quenax-briath-briax

Remediation includes a revised component specification, extended inspection at final assembly, and a proactive repair programme for affected serial ranges. Estimated remediation cost is within the contingency reserve, though it constrains discretionary spending through year-end. Full claims analysis is appended. The confidential planning implications are set out below.

confidential, kagup-bafog: Fraaxax Group is in early talks to buy Soroxox Group for about $343.8 million. The Olidor launch date is June 14, and nothing goes to the press before then. Legal wants the Aldmirek Logistics term sheet signed before July 23.